For the Juniors: How do mangrove trees survive?
A video that takes students on a journey to discover how mangroves thrive in extreme conditions where most plants cannot survive. From salt filtration to aerial roots, explore the remarkable adaptations that make mangroves unique and essential to coastal ecosystems.
